Lenetta Atkins, 82, passed away on January 29, 2017 at The Rehabilitation Center of Des Moines.

Lenetta was born October 22, 1934 to Lenzie and Zelmar Braddy in Braxton, Mississippi. She attended Piney Woods School in Mississippi and went on to receive her Bachelor’s Degree in education from Tougaloo College. Lenetta taught school in Clarksdale, Mississippi during the 1950’s. In 1960, while visiting family in Des Moines, she met her husband to be, Reginald Atkins. Lenetta began working for Mercy Hospital in 1962 as a library clerk and later became the librarian until she retired in 2014. While working at Mercy, she earned a Master’s Degree on May 6, 1989 from the University of Iowa. Lenetta and her husband, Reggie loved to travel and they did a lot of it over the years.
